**Vendor note: Inkmill markdown pipeline**

Rendering for Parchway docs is outsourced to Inkmill under an annual contract, renewing each March. They handle sanitization and PDF export; we own the upload queue. SLA: 4-hour response on rendering failures. Escalate only after two failed retries. Their support desk is reachable at the address below.

billing contact of hahaf-baguf = zorael.tammir.jorius@sivrelhq.internal

Document Transport — Print Shop Master Copies

Quick guide for moving master copies to Bramblehurst Print Co. These are the only originals, so treat the run like a valuables transfer, not a regular parcel drop. Use the red tamper-evident envelopes from the supply shelf, log the seal number in the transport book, and never combine the run with general mail. The masters go directly to the press supervisor, nobody else. On arrival, the courier must follow the hand-over instruction stated below.

drop instructions, kajep-tageg: the kasvan casdor courier leaves the quenvan quenox druox ledger at gate 4316 under passcode 799004

/*
 * PROCTOR_QUEUE_MAX_DEPTH caps how many exam sessions the Vigilum
 * proctoring queue will hold before new check-ins are deferred to the
 * overflow pool. Raising it without resizing the reviewer pool causes
 * review latency to exceed the contractual window, so treat changes as
 * capacity decisions, not tuning tweaks. Any adjustment must be paired
 * with a load-test run, and the run is tied to the token recorded below.
 */

pipeline stamp: htk31_694f19c189d5f2e2b172861d5999a1e

# Build Provenance: GlimmerProbe GPU Profiler

All GlimmerProbe releases are built from tagged sources on the Hollowmere build farm. Plugin authors should verify that the profiler shim they link against matches a published tag, since memory-sampling hooks change between minor versions. Unsigned builds are not supported for plugin certification. Each certified artifact carries the token shown below.

pipeline stamp: htk31_f769b577b3028a4e9958e5bb8d1259a